I was originally just going to share this feed, but then I realized that doing so might imply endorsement of DCist’s position.

The Hill has the idiot local news scoop of the day with this gem from the Columbia Heights location of the Washington Sports Club. Presumptive Democratic presidential nominee Sen. Barack Obama stopped by earlier on Friday to check out the new facility (he usually goes to the one in Gallery Place), and the woman who works behind the counter didn’t recognize him and made him show her his ID. Now, the tone of the article suggests the embarrassing part of the story is that no one at the gym recognized Obama, one of the most recognizable faces in the country. But we’ll submit that it’s somewhat rather more embarrassing that Obama felt he didn’t need to swipe his membership card at the front desk. We all have to face the shame and doubt that comes along with wondering whether the front desk person can tell how long it’s been since we’ve been to the gym, senator. Next time, swipe that card.

No. No, no, no.

a) It’s fucking awesome that Barack Obama knows the city well enough to go check out a new branch of his gym in Columbia Heights.

b) The gym employees should be mildly embarrassed (and appear to be, judging by the original Hill article; DCist fails to note that they almost immediately caught their own mistake and responded with appropriate self-deprecating humor).

c) There’s nothing remotely embarrassing about being six months away from being sworn in as President of the United States, going to a different part of the city with a necessary massive security entourage, and accidentally forgetting a gym ID card.

d) Barack Obama was hanging out in my neighborhood! How much cooler could he be? The FISA sell-out is totally forgiven.
